- Melun, France
- http://cdss.snw999.com/space-uid-1846545.html
-
Discover the top built-in ovens UK has to offer. From sleek designs to innovative features, find the perfect built-in oven to elevate your kitchen experience.
- Joined on
2026-01-19
Block a user
Sort